DORMAN v. PADGETT
Plaintiff: BENJI DORMAN
Defendant: Sheriff WAYNE PADGETT
Case Number: 4:2022cv00358
Filed: September 30, 2022
Court: US District Court for the Northern District of Florida
Presiding Judge: MICHAEL J FRANK
Referring Judge: ALLEN C WINSOR
Nature of Suit: Labor: Family and Medical Leave Act
Cause of Action: 29 U.S.C. ยง 2601 Family and Medical Leave Act
Jury Demanded By: Plaintiff
